Строки типа String представляют собой фрагмент текста. Например:
"Good afternoon"
"Happy birthday! "
Для инициализации используют следующую конструкцию:
message — является именем переменной;
"Hello World" — строка, присваиваемая переменной message.
Важно: текст строки заключается в кавычки.
Чтобы соединить несколько строк вместе, используется конкатенация (+) — соединение нескольких кусочков текста в один.
В классе String есть готовые методы для работы со строками. При этом, чтобы использовать тот или иной метод, необходимо воспользоваться оператором «точка» (.).
- Метод length() — отображает количество символов строки. Пример:
- Метод toUpperCase() — преобразовывает символы в верхний регистр.
- Метод toLowerCase() — преобразовывает символы в нижний регистр.
- Метод substring() — служит для выделения подстрок.
- Метод charAt() — возвращает символ с указанной позиции.
метод equals() — проверяет равенство двух строк. Пример:
в этом примере переменная equalsOrNot является истинной, в то время как яequalsOrNot2 имеет значение false.
Метод split() — разделяет строку на несколько частей. Пример: